
| ||||||||||||||||||||||||
| Comfort Software :: Форумы :: Обсуждение возможностей | |||
|
|||
|
| Автор | Добавил |
| Comfort |
| ||
![]() ![]() ![]() Зарегистрирован: Wed Sep 19 2007, 03:42PM Сообщений: 617 | _mon_ написал(а) ... _mon_ написал(а) ... Такое поведение зависит от программы. Предоставляет информацию о положении курсора - можно показать флаг рядом.у меня в Win2000Sp4, кроме упомянутых в хелпе оперы и фокса, не отображается раскладка также в Word2000Sp3 и консольных программах (cmd.exe, Far.exe), хотя я слышал, в WinXpSp2 работает. т.е. программа ведет себя по-разному в Win2000 и WinXP? Этой дала курсор, этой дала, а win2000 нет? Повторюсь. Моя программа тут не при чем. Она может давать флаг только тогда, когда знает куда его давать. Для этого есть специальные функции в Windows, которые некоторые разработчики не используют в своих программах. _mon_ написал(а) ... _mon_ написал(а) ... 2. возможность изменять цвет каретки в зависимости от текущей раскладки. Технически невозможно, т.к. очень многие приложения рисуют курсор собственными средствами. Т.е. у вас не создается своя каретка, а на канве или еще как-то выводится рисунок рядом? Думаю вам будет интересно посмотреть на программу Aml Maple (см. выделенную отдельно альфа версию). В ней реализована цветная каретка, мизерный размер программы и не более 2Мб в памяти. Хотя, к сожалению пока в win2000 не отображается тоже в некоторых приложениях. Но в winXP и Висте по утверждению тестеров все работает (за исключением пресловутых оперы и firefox) Вот когда упомянутая Вами программа научится отображать флаг рядом с текстовым курсором, а не с мышинным, тогда и посмотрим. Сделать флаг рядом с курсором мыши гораздо легче, но с моей точки зрения это неудобно. Если вам удобно, то используйте ее. Have a nice day | ||
| Наверх |
| Модераторы: Comfort |